I am moving to Grenada. Throughout the year, the temp is 80-85 degrees F during the day, and 65-75 at night. During the wet season the air is humid and there are frequent torrential showers. I need an everyday rain jacket that is very breathable and dry. Do you recommend this jacket or the north face prophecy jacket?

These two jackets use the same Hyvent DT waterproof/breathable coating, so functionally these two are going to be very similar. The advantage with the Prophecy is that the jacket is a little lighter/more packable than the Venture Jacket- it also uses waterproof zippers rather than a storm flap. I believe either jacket would be very good for the environment down there.

Tech Specs:

Material:
[Shell] HyVent DT; [Lining] nylon 
Waterproof Rating:
25psi 
Breathable Rating:
625g / m 
Center Back Length:
28in [M] 
Core Venting:
Underarm zips 
Pockets:
2 Hand 
Seam Taped:
Yes, fully 
Hood:
Yes 
Weight:
13.4oz (379g) 
Recommended Use:
Hiking, backpacking 
Manufacturer Warranty:
Lifetime 
Country of Origin:
Bangladesh
